postgresql服务器编程:实战经验和技巧 如何使用postgresql进行服务器编程:5个实用实例演练

   抖音SEO    

在本教程中,我们将提供一些有关PostgreSQL服务器编程的实例,包括数据库连接、查询执行和事务处理等关键概念。通过这些实例,开发者可以学习如何使用PostgreSQL进行高效的数据操作和存储过程开发,从而提升应用程序的性能和可靠性。

数据库

数据库连接

首先,让我们了解如何建立与PostgreSQL数据库的连接。在这个例子中,我们将使用Java语言来演示连接到数据库的过程。

import java.sql.Connection;
import java.sql.DriverManager;

public class DBConnection {
  public static void main(String[] args) {
    String url = "jdbc:postgresql://localhost:5432/mydatabase"; //数据库连接URL
    String username = "myuser";
    String password = "mypassword";
    
    try {
      Connection connection = DriverManager.getConnection(url, username, password);
      System.out.println("连接成功!");
    } catch (Exception e) {
      System.out.println("连接失败:" + e.getMessage());
    }
  }
}

查询执行

接下来,让我们学习如何执行查询操作。以下是一个使用PostgreSQL的SELECT语句查询数据的示例。

SELECT * FROM users WHERE age > 18;

这个查询将返回年龄大于18岁的用户。

数据库查询

事务处理

在数据库编程中,事务处理是非常重要的一部分。事务可以保证一系列数据库操作的原子性和一致性。以下是一个使用PostgreSQL的事务处理的示例。

BEGIN; --开始事务
INSERT INTO users (name, age) VALUES ('John', 25);
UPDATE accounts SET balance = balance - 100 WHERE user_id = 1;
COMMIT; --提交事务

在这个示例中,我们首先开始一个事务,然后执行插入和更新操作,最后提交事务。

结尾和推荐相关问题

在本教程中,我们介绍了PostgreSQL服务器编程的一些实例,包括数据库连接、查询执行和事务处理。这些示例可以帮助开发者学习如何使用PostgreSQL进行高效的数据操作和存储过程开发。

如果您对PostgreSQL服务器编程有任何疑问或需要进一步的帮助,请随时在下方评论区留言。感谢您的阅读和支持!请为本文点赞、分享,并关注我们以获取更多有关数据库编程的实用技巧和教程。

谢谢您的观看和支持!

评论留言

我要留言

欢迎参与讨论,请在这里发表您的看法、交流您的观点。